#23fe67 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23fe67 is composed of 13.7% red, 99.6%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.4%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 138.6 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 56.7%. #23fe67 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ffce with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#23fe67
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000e04 is the darkest color, while #fafff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#23fe67
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#89988e is the less saturated color, while #23fe67 is the most saturated one.
